Antibody and autoantibody relevanceSeroatlas analysis
Seroatlas reads CCDC177 as an antibody target. Whether an autoantibody or antibody against CCDC177 could matter depends on whether native CCDC177 is physically reachable, whether the body needs it intact, and whether it acts in a disease-relevant tissue.
CCDC177 is annotated as predominantly intracellular. Intracellular proteins are common autoantibody markers, becoming visible to the immune system after cell injury or altered processing, but are usually markers of disease rather than direct drivers.
